## Support

ChirpRelay emits a very high log volume by design, so we sample at 1% in production by default. Before filing a support request, confirm whether your missing entries fall outside the sampled window — most "lost log" reports do. Include the service revision, sampling rate, and a rough timestamp range. For sampling overrides or debug-level captures, contact the observability crew.

billing contact of bagep-yawig = istmir_casox@zemvarworks.internal

Test plan: EXIF scrubbing in the Pictora upload pipeline. Plugin authors should verify that GPS, serial, and timestamp fields are stripped before thumbnails render. Submit sample images through the staging scrubber and confirm metadata is empty on retrieval. Staging requires authentication on every call; include the following bearer token in your requests:

portal login ticket: eyJhbGciOiJIUzI1NiIsInR5cCI6IkpXVCJ9.eyJzdWIiOiIwEOsktwVNwIn0.-UJU3fdyyCgG

**Ticket #CAT-IMPORT — Stalled catalogue import from Brindlemoor branch**

The nightly import of the Brindlemoor branch catalogue into Shelfwright stalls at roughly 60% when records contain multi-volume set entries; the parser treats the volume delimiter as a new record and the dedupe pass then loops. Workaround in place: pre-split sets upstream. Proper fix lands this sprint. For the weekly sync, the reproducing import job ran under the trace token recorded just below.

pipeline stamp: htk21_9e3498a7a110f68c71435

## Formula sandbox tuning

User-supplied formulas in Gridmoor execute inside a restricted interpreter with hard ceilings on time, memory, and call depth. Reviewers should confirm any change to these ceilings is justified in the PR description, since raising them widens the abuse surface. Defaults were chosen from production traces. The current limits are as follows.

limits module of tafog-fawip:
WEIGHTS = {
    "julix": 57,
    "lamys": 992,
    "kasvan": 209,
    "quenok": 750,
    "alddor": 259,
    "oliath": 1009,
    "wenix": 815,
}